El Salvador President Nayib Bukele once again demonstrated his determination in the fight against crime. In a video he shared on social media, he presented images of criminals in the high-security CECOT prison to his followers and stated, "A well-managed prison system is the necessary first step to transform a hellish environment into a safe, reliable community."
El Salvador President Nayib Bukele shared images of criminals in a CECOT (Terrorism Confinement Center) prison on his social media account.

The images featured criminals associated with drug gangs in the country as well as immigrants sent from the U.S., while Bukele reiterated his message of toughness in the fight against crime.
Bukele stated, "They say that a prison sentence is not enough to escape crime. However, a strong police force and a strict, well-managed prison system are the necessary first steps to transform a hellish environment into a safe, reliable community."
